    Description

    We are an active, multicultural (Australian-German) family of five with three spirited boys between 6 and 11 years of age. Together we live in a former bar and guest house with lots of atmosphere and space for family and friends. The former dancehall, when not a giant play space for kids, is used for cultural events, bringing some diversity and culture to the old east German countryside. The fireplace and sauna help to survive the grey and cold winter days.

    We have chickens, herb and vegetable gardens, a bonfire circle, a greenhouse, and a small natural pond which invites a refreshing splash or wake-up dip on the sunny days.

    We try to live as organically as possible, sustainability deep in our hearts. The house and garden transform throughout the year with the seasons, as does the experience of them.

    Any creative minds interested in doing a small art project or installation (maybe involving the kids) are very welcome. We would LOVE that!

    On some days the work involves helping to keep the household going (cooking and cleaning!). Also, we are looking at new ways to help around supporting our kids as Kate returns to practising as a psychologist - maybe you are interested in aupairing or nannying with us?

    The kids enjoy learning trying to learn languages, currently trending are french, italian and spanish. Leo would love to learn Mandarin.

    Of course, we are always happy to help you with your german language learning, if you would like that.

    We have an old grand piano, a drum kit, electric and acoustic guitar, some ukuleles and love to hear music and singing in the house.

    We have gradually become seasoned Workaway hosts with many wonderful experiences through the platform and are looking forward to many more :).

    We especially welcome couples!

    Aide

    Its a big old house with an even bigger garden, so a pair of extra hands is very welcome to plant, harvest, cut, clean, repair, tidy, build, paint, cook, play, dig, and design. There is always lots to be done!

    The three kids are very sociable and happy about an extra portion of attention: kicking the ball through the garden, baking cakes, reading books, etc. We are open to someone who would like to do more kid-caring, but this is not necessary.

    Projects in the pipeline:
    - art installation on house walls and in garden
    - finishing the little wagon for summer guest accommodation
    - converting a Trabant (old east german car) from petrol to electric drive
    - building a fully self sufficient straw bale house, which turns with the sun
    - organising community film nights
    - reviving the dance hall for concerts and events
    - leaving consumerism behind us
    - reducing our waste and consumerism

    Hébergement

    There are four guest rooms with shared and separate bathrooms. The kitchen and loungeroom are common spaces. We are also in the process (help welcome!) of converting a former bee wagon into a quiet space at the end of the garden, which provides a separate and children-free zone in the warmer months.

  • Autres infos...

    Autres infos...

    We live in the lovely Brandenburg countryside - a good place to enjoy open spaces and fresh air.

    Our village is peaceful and friendly, surrounded by fields and forests (deer, wild boar, foxes, badgers, moles, hawks, cranes, wild geese, maybe even a wolf!) with a sweet swimming lake nearby. We offer guest bikes.

    The magnificent Berlin is easily accessible by train (1 hour from the Berlin Main Station) and we can offer people a lift to and from the local train station (Briesen Mark, 15 minutes away). There is a bus, though not frequent, that can allow guests to be entirely independent.

    We have a recent addition to our family, a little poodle called Honey.
